\ This file contains primitive specifications in the following format:
\ 
\ forth name	( stack effect )	category	[pronunciation]
\ [""glossary entry""]
\ C code
\ [:
\ Forth code]
\ 
\ Note: Fields in brackets are optional.  Word specifications have to
\ be separated by at least one empty line
\
\ Both pronounciation and stack items (in the stack effect) must
\ conform to the C identifier syntax or the C compiler will complain.
\ If you don't have a pronounciation field, the Forth name is used,
\ and has to conform to the C identifier syntax.
\ 
\ These specifications are automatically translated into C-code for the
\ interpreter and into some other files. I hope that your C compiler has
\ decent optimization, otherwise the automatically generated code will
\ be somewhat slow. The Forth version of the code is included for manual
\ compilers, so they will need to compile only the important words.
\ 
\ Note that stack pointer adjustment is performed according to stack
\ effect by automatically generated code and NEXT is automatically
\ appended to the C code. Also, you can use the names in the stack
\ effect in the C code. Stack access is automatic. One exception: if
\ your code does not fall through, the results are not stored into the
\ stack. Use different names on both sides of the '--', if you change a
\ value (some stores to the stack are optimized away).
\
\ For superinstructions the syntax is:
\
\ forth-name [/ c-name] = forth-name forth-name ...
\
\ 
\ The stack variables have the following types:
\ 
\ name matches	type
\ f.*		Bool
\ c.*		Char
\ [nw].*	Cell
\ u.*		UCell
\ d.*		DCell
\ ud.*		UDCell
\ r.*		Float
\ a_.*		Cell *
\ c_.*		Char *
\ f_.*		Float *
\ df_.*		DFloat *
\ sf_.*		SFloat *
\ xt.*		XT
\ f83name.*	F83Name *
